Planned DevelopmentAmend the Uses Permitted Conditions to permit Auto Body Repair in Area A of the planned development
The applicant wants to add auto body repair as an allowed use on a 2.0-acre tract within the planned development. If approved, an auto body repair shop would operate in Area A, with service bays facing toward commercial development on Centennial Drive rather than toward nearby residential neighborhoods.
